Abstract
We investigate the consequence of vector leptoquarks on the rare semileptonic lepton flavor violating decays of the B meson which are more promising and effective channels to probe the new physics signal. We constrain the resulting new leptoquark parameter space by using the branching ratios of Bs,d→l+l-, KL→l+l- and τ-→l-γ processes. We estimate the branching ratios of rare lepton flavor violating B→K(π)li-lj+ processes using the constrained leptoquark couplings. We also compute the forward-backward asymmetries and the lepton nonuniversality parameters of the LFV decays in the vector leptoquark model. Furthermore, we study the effect of vector leptoquark on the (g-2)μ anomaly.
